Frequently Asked Questions

What matters more: usage or revenue in early EdTech?

Usage and retention matter first. Investors want to see that learners or institutions keep using the product. Revenue follows once value is clear.

How do investors view long sales cycles with schools?

They are expected, but you should show progress through pilots, trials, and renewals rather than a pipeline of vague conversations.

Is direct-to-learner or institutional EdTech easier to fund?

Both can be funded. Direct-to-learner needs strong consumer metrics; institutional EdTech needs clear procurement paths and renewal patterns.
